On Tuesday, February 28, 2017, President Donald Trump will deliver his address to a Joint Session of Congress at around 6 p.m. NPR will provide live anchored coverage of the president’s speech as well as the Democratic response. This will be the first address to Congress of President Donald Trump's presidency. The address comes a day after Trump gave an outline of his budget plan for Congress, which would increase defense spending and make cuts to domestic programs.

Shortly after the president concludes, Former Kentucky Governor Steve Beshear will deliver the Democratic Response to President Trump’s address. Beshear was chosen by Democratic Party leaders for his record, expanding affordable health care.
